Who are we?
The Association of African Canadian Initiatives of New Brunswick (AIAC-NB) works for the cultural, social, economic and civic development of of New Brunswick's French-speaking Afro-Canadian community, while promoting the diversity of the linguistic context.

Objective
The objective of the association is to:

Contribute to the well-being of African-Canadians in New Brunswick

Promote the culture, talents and skills of African-Canadians in New Brunswick

Encourage the participation of African-Canadians in citizen initiatives

Work towards growing and successful immigration of Afro-descendants to New Brunswick

Participate in the influence of African-Canadians in New Brunswick in their community
Vision
Our vision is of a province where every African-Canadian achieves self-fulfillment by mobilizing their full potential, talents and knowledge to contribute actively and positively to society.
